California Ex-Police Official Tops State Payroll With $1.2 Million Payday

California Ex-Police Official Tops State Payroll With $1.2 Million Payday Former Redlands Police Deputy Chief Travis Martinez received nearly $1.2 million in wages in 2025, the highest reported compensation for any city employee in California, according to newly released data from the State Controller's Office and reporting by the New York Post. Payroll records show Martinez collected $81,804 in regular pay, $890,467 in other compensation and $231,099 in lump-sum payments before retiring in April.
